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ite has a general score of 89.7, which is much better than the realme X50 5G's global score of 73. Even though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ite and realme X50 5G were released only a few months apart,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ite is a bit thinner and a little bit lighter. The realme X50 5G and the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ite both feature very similar screens, because although the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ite has a bit worse number of pixels per inch of screen, and they both have an equal 1080 x 2400 pixels resolution, it also counts with a little bit bigger display.
Realme X50 5G and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ite both count with similar processors, and although the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ite has 2 GB more RAM memory, they both have the same number of cores. Galaxy S10 Lite takes just a bit better photographs and videos than realme X50 5G, because although it has a tinier aperture which is not so good for low light photography and video, and they both have a same resolution back-facing camera and the same 3840x2160 video definition, the Galaxy S10 Lite also counts with faster 60 fps video frame rate.
The Galaxy S10 Lite has a lot bigger memory capacity to install games and applications than realme X50 5G, and although they both have the same 128 GB internal storage capacity, the Galaxy S10 Lite also has a SD card slot that admits up to 1000 GB. Samsung Galaxy S10 Lite counts with a little better battery life than realme X50 5G, because it has a 7% greater battery size.
